085 | Once Upon a Time in America ft. Kyle Stuck


Listen Later

Connor & Jon are joined by Kyle Stuck to discuss Sergio Leone's gangster epic. The crew has mixed feelings about the film, but gush on the score and cinematography. They argue over whether the characters are too unlikable, if Detroit Joe is too greasy, and was it all just a dream?

 

WARNING: Major spoilers for Once Upon a Time in America
